The N ½ NW ¼ 19-6-1, Mulberry Township, Clay County, Kansas.
This farm is located three miles south and five miles west of Clifton; or two miles east and one mile north of St. Joseph. This is the northwest corner of the farm, at the intersection of Oat/28th Road and Meridian Road (the Clay/Cloud County line.)
The farm, 80 acres, more or less, consists of approximately 55 acres terraced, gently to moderately sloping upland cropland, three acres waterways, with the rest of the place being old farmstead and native pasture overgrown with trees and brush.
In 2008, the cropland was all in milo.
The FSA bases and yields are 39.9 acres wheat, 30 bushels; 14.9 acres milo, 47 bushels; and .8 acre soybeans, 24 bushels.
The 2007 taxes were $367.68.
